Suggest Medication For TMJ

I am a TMJ sufferer and have just within the last 2 weeks or so have encountered pain that I have never experienced and do not know what to do. I have two different spints, all types of drugs and nothing seems to work. What would you recommend that would work the best?

Dentist, Oral and Maxillofacial Surgery 's  Response
Thanks for your query, i have gone through your query. The best medicine for the TMJ disorder is piroxicam tablets 20mg twice daily on first day and once daily for next 6days(if you are not allergic). do not open your mouth too wide, do not take hard food, even while yawning support your jaw. if the tablet does not work then you can try orthocentesis(intraarticular lavage with saline or autologous blood).
consult a oral physician and get it done. i hope my answer will help you. take care.
